 105static struct commit_graft {
 106        unsigned char sha1[20];
 107        int nr_parent;
 108        unsigned char parent[0][20]; /* more */
 109} **commit_graft;
 110static int commit_graft_alloc, commit_graft_nr;
 111
 112static int commit_graft_pos(const unsigned char *sha1)
 113{
 114        int lo, hi;
 115        lo = 0;
 116        hi = commit_graft_nr;
 117        while (lo < hi) {
 118                int mi = (lo + hi) / 2;
 119                struct commit_graft *graft = commit_graft[mi];
 120                int cmp = memcmp(sha1, graft->sha1, 20);
 121                if (!cmp)
 122                        return mi;
 123                if (cmp < 0)
 124                        hi = mi;
 125                else
 126                        lo = mi + 1;
 127        }
 128        return -lo - 1;
 129}
 130
 131static void prepare_commit_graft(void)
 132{
 133        char *graft_file = get_graft_file();
 134        FILE *fp = fopen(graft_file, "r");
 135        char buf[1024];
 136        if (!fp) {
 137                commit_graft = (struct commit_graft **) "hack";
 138                return;
 139        }
 140        while (fgets(buf, sizeof(buf), fp)) {
 141                /* The format is just "Commit Parent1 Parent2 ...\n" */
 142                int len = strlen(buf);
 143                int i;
 144                struct commit_graft *graft = NULL;
 145
 146                if (buf[len-1] == '\n')
 147                        buf[--len] = 0;
 148                if (buf[0] == '#')
 149                        continue;
 150                if ((len + 1) % 41) {
 151                bad_graft_data:
 152                        error("bad graft data: %s", buf);
 153                        free(graft);
 154                        continue;
 155                }
 156                i = (len + 1) / 41 - 1;
 157                graft = xmalloc(sizeof(*graft) + 20 * i);
 158                graft->nr_parent = i;
 159                if (get_sha1_hex(buf, graft->sha1))
 160                        goto bad_graft_data;
 161                for (i = 40; i < len; i += 41) {
 162                        if (buf[i] != ' ')
 163                                goto bad_graft_data;
 164                        if (get_sha1_hex(buf + i + 1, graft->parent[i/41]))
 165                                goto bad_graft_data;
 166                }
 167                i = commit_graft_pos(graft->sha1);
 168                if (0 <= i) {
 169                        error("duplicate graft data: %s", buf);
 170                        free(graft);
 171                        continue;
 172                }
 173                i = -i - 1;
 174                if (commit_graft_alloc <= ++commit_graft_nr) {
 175                        commit_graft_alloc = alloc_nr(commit_graft_alloc);
 176                        commit_graft = xrealloc(commit_graft,
 177                                                sizeof(*commit_graft) *
 178                                                commit_graft_alloc);
 179                }
 180                if (i < commit_graft_nr)
 181                        memmove(commit_graft + i + 1,
 182                                commit_graft + i,
 183                                (commit_graft_nr - i - 1) *
 184                                sizeof(*commit_graft));
 185                commit_graft[i] = graft;
 186        }
 187        fclose(fp);
 188}
 189
 190static struct commit_graft *lookup_commit_graft(const unsigned char *sha1)
 191{
 192        int pos;
 193        if (!commit_graft)
 194                prepare_commit_graft();
 195        pos = commit_graft_pos(sha1);
 196        if (pos < 0)
 197                return NULL;
 198        return commit_graft[pos];
 199}
 200
 201int parse_commit_buffer(struct commit *item, void *buffer, unsigned long size)
 202{
 203        char *bufptr = buffer;
 204        unsigned char parent[20];
 205        struct commit_list **pptr;
 206        struct commit_graft *graft;
 207
 208        if (item->object.parsed)
 209                return 0;
 210        item->object.parsed = 1;
 211        if (memcmp(bufptr, "tree ", 5))
 212                return error("bogus commit object %s", sha1_to_hex(item->object.sha1));
 213        if (get_sha1_hex(bufptr + 5, parent) < 0)
 214                return error("bad tree pointer in commit %s\n", sha1_to_hex(item->object.sha1));
 215        item->tree = lookup_tree(parent);
 216        if (item->tree)
 217                add_ref(&item->object, &item->tree->object);
 218        bufptr += 46; /* "tree " + "hex sha1" + "\n" */
 219        pptr = &item->parents;
 220
 221        graft = lookup_commit_graft(item->object.sha1);
 222        while (!memcmp(bufptr, "parent ", 7)) {
 223                struct commit *new_parent;
 224
 225                if (get_sha1_hex(bufptr + 7, parent) || bufptr[47] != '\n')
 226                        return error("bad parents in commit %s", sha1_to_hex(item->object.sha1));
 227                bufptr += 48;
 228                if (graft)
 229                        continue;
 230                new_parent = lookup_commit(parent);
 231                if (new_parent) {
 232                        pptr = &commit_list_insert(new_parent, pptr)->next;
 233                        add_ref(&item->object, &new_parent->object);
 234                }
 235        }
 236        if (graft) {
 237                int i;
 238                struct commit *new_parent;
 239                for (i = 0; i < graft->nr_parent; i++) {
 240                        new_parent = lookup_commit(graft->parent[i]);
 241                        if (!new_parent)
 242                                continue;
 243                        pptr = &commit_list_insert(new_parent, pptr)->next;
 244                        add_ref(&item->object, &new_parent->object);
 245                }
 246        }
 247        item->date = parse_commit_date(bufptr);
 248        return 0;
 249}

 533/*
 534 * Performs an in-place topological sort on the list supplied.
 535 */
 536void sort_in_topological_order(struct commit_list ** list)
 537{
 538        struct commit_list * next = *list;
 539        struct commit_list * work = NULL;
 540        struct commit_list ** pptr = list;
 541        struct sort_node * nodes;
 542        struct sort_node * next_nodes;
 543        int count = 0;
 544
 545        /* determine the size of the list */
 546        while (next) {
 547                next = next->next;
 548                count++;
 549        }
 550        /* allocate an array to help sort the list */
 551        nodes = xcalloc(count, sizeof(*nodes));
 552        /* link the list to the array */
 553        next_nodes = nodes;
 554        next=*list;
 555        while (next) {
 556                next_nodes->list_item = next;
 557                next->item->object.util = next_nodes;
 558                next_nodes++;
 559                next = next->next;
 560        }
 561        /* update the indegree */
 562        next=*list;
 563        while (next) {
 564                struct commit_list * parents = next->item->parents;
 565                while (parents) {
 566                        struct commit * parent=parents->item;
 567                        struct sort_node * pn = (struct sort_node *)parent->object.util;
 568                        
 569                        if (pn)
 570                                pn->indegree++;
 571                        parents=parents->next;
 572                }
 573                next=next->next;
 574        }
 575        /* 
 576         * find the tips
 577         *
 578         * tips are nodes not reachable from any other node in the list 
 579         * 
 580         * the tips serve as a starting set for the work queue.
 581         */
 582        next=*list;
 583        while (next) {
 584                struct sort_node * node = (struct sort_node *)next->item->object.util;
 585
 586                if (node->indegree == 0) {
 587                        commit_list_insert(next->item, &work);
 588                }
 589                next=next->next;
 590        }
 591        /* process the list in topological order */
 592        while (work) {
 593                struct commit * work_item = pop_commit(&work);
 594                struct sort_node * work_node = (struct sort_node *)work_item->object.util;
 595                struct commit_list * parents = work_item->parents;
 596
 597                while (parents) {
 598                        struct commit * parent=parents->item;
 599                        struct sort_node * pn = (struct sort_node *)parent->object.util;
 600                        
 601                        if (pn) {
 602                                /* 
 603                                 * parents are only enqueued for emission 
 604                                 * when all their children have been emitted thereby
 605                                 * guaranteeing topological order.
 606                                 */
 607                                pn->indegree--;
 608                                if (!pn->indegree) 
 609                                        commit_list_insert(parent, &work);
 610                        }
 611                        parents=parents->next;
 612                }
 613                /*
 614                 * work_item is a commit all of whose children
 615                 * have already been emitted. we can emit it now.
 616                 */
 617                *pptr = work_node->list_item;
 618                pptr = &(*pptr)->next;
 619                *pptr = NULL;
 620                work_item->object.util = NULL;
 621        }
 622        free(nodes);
 623}
